Riemannian manifolds

\(\mathcal{M}\) high-dimensional "surface" that locally resembles a vector space.

Endow vector space with a metric.

Examples:

- Sphere \(S^{p-1}= \{x\in\mathbb{R}^p| \enspace \|x\|=1\}\)

- Orthogonal matrices $$\mathcal{O}_p = \{X\in \mathbb{R}^{p\times p}| \enspace X^\top X = I_p\}$$

- Positive matrices \(S^{++}_p\)

Well studied mathematical objects

One motivation: robust neural networks

Trained without care, a neural network is susceptible to adversarial attacks

Given data \(x\), a small perturbation \(\delta\) such that \(\|f_{\theta}(x + \delta) - f_{\theta}(x)\|\gg \|\delta\|\)

Goodfellow, Ian J., Jonathon Shlens, and Christian Szegedy. "Explaining and harnessing adversarial examples."

Certified robustness with orthogonal weights

Idea : The map \(x\mapsto Wx\) is norm preserving when \(W^\top W = I_p\)

 

We can stack such transforms to get networks such that

$$\|f_{\theta}(x + \delta) - f_{\theta}(x)\| \leq \|\delta\|$$

Certified robustness !

Training a network with orthogonal weights

Training = optimization

Training with orthogonal weights = optimization on a manifold

Well established field but deep learning brings a new context:

  • Hardware: use of GPU's
  • Massive data: need to use stochastic algorithms

Contribution:

Fast training of neural nets with orthogonal weights
